Mineralna gustoća kosti u bolesnika sa seronegativnim spondiloartropatijama [Bone mineral density in patients with seronegative spondylarthropathies]

Abstract

Objective. The aim of this study was to analyze bone mineral density (BMD) in patients with seronegative spondylarthropathy, to determine the frequency of osteoporosis, to investigate the relationship between BMD and clinical, laboratory, and radiological variables in patients with seronegative spondyloartropathy, to define the relationship between bone growth (syndesmophytes) and bone loss, and to determine the frequency of vertebral fractures. ----- Methods. 237 patients with seronegative spondyloartropathy (157 women, 80 men) and 100 healthy controls were recruited to the study. Lumbar spine, hip and forearm BMD were measured by dual energy X-ray absorptiometry. Radiographs of the lumbar spine were used to analyze syndesmophytes and vertebral fractures. ----- Results. Compared with age-matched controls, patients with seronegative spondyloartropathy had a significantly lower BMD in the lumbar spine (1,217±0,148 g/cm2 vrs 1,049±0,216 g/cm2) and in the total hip (1,086±0,168 g/cm2 vrs 0,968±0,174 g/cm2), (p<0,001). Osteoporosis was observed in 57 (24,1%) patients. Presence of syndesmophytes and vertebral fractures significantly correlated with BMD. Vertebral fracture was observed in 99 (41,8%) patients. ----- Conclusion. Patients with seronegative spondyloartropathy had lower BMD in comparison with healthy controls. The demineralization was related to the disease duration, low bone mass index, smoking and the number of years since menopause. Bone mass loss in seronegative spondyloartropathy is better evaluated at the femur because syndesmophytes are common finding in this group of patients.
